Krish schrieb: > Yes, GWT application is embedded into html page(i.e. GWT compiler > converts java file to js file). But after conversion, I can't use any > of my custom taglibs(i.e. as I dont have any control on compiled > code).
I'm still not sure if we're talking about the same thing. Even after compilation there still is a HTML-page that loads the Javascript- file containing the application. This page can of course contain taglibs that are processed by the server before it's served to a client. All the things that are compiled to Javascript are processed by the client (browser) so taglibs are not possible, because they need to be processed by the server. But you of course can start requests to the server by using RequestBuilder and present the result in a HTML-widget.
